c语言-汽油计算

[复制链接]
查看11 | 回复0 | 2010-3-10 22:45:49 | 显示全部楼层 |阅读模式
啊?这样啊!不好意思,等我看看,我回去看,一有空,我就来上网。#include#includevoid main(){ int mileage1,mileage,NUM,i,j,k[80]={0},max,mnum; double liter1,liter,mpl[80]={0}; printf("请输入您的数据对数:"); scanf("%d",&NUM); printf("请输入您的第1对数据:\n总公里数:\n"); scanf("%d",&mileage1); printf("剩下油量:\n"); scanf("%lf",&liter1); for(i=1;i<NUM;i++) {printf("请输入您的第%d对数据:\n总公里数:\n",i+1);scanf("%d",&mileage);printf("剩下油量:\n");scanf("%lf",&liter);mpl=(mileage-mileage1)/(liter1-liter);mileage1=mileage;
liter1=liter; }
for(i=1;i<NUM-1;i++)for(j=i+1;j<NUM;j++) if(mpl==mpl[j])k++;
for(i=1,max=k[1],mnum=1;i<NUM-1;i++)for(j=i+1;j<NUM;j++)
if(max<k){ max=k; mnum=i;}
printf("The value of miles-per-liter is %.2lf公里/升.\n",mpl[mnum]);}
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

主题

0

回帖

4882万

积分

论坛元老

Rank: 8Rank: 8

积分
48824836
热门排行